## Environments: Driftline SDK Parity

Driftline ships two client SDKs, Kestrel (mobile) and Heron (web). Parity is tracked per environment: features land in dev for both, but staging gates Heron behind the compatibility matrix. Never test parity against prod. Mismatched capability lists usually mean staging flags diverged, not SDK bugs. New joiners: check the parity board before filing anything. Staging currently uses the following values.

service settings:
[casax]
port = 6379
team = rusir
host = casax.zemvarhq.corp
region = outer-4
access_code = ac_9808ce
timeout_ms = 1500

## Break-Glass Access: Config Hot-Reload (Team Sparrowjay)

New folks: the Lanternfell gateway hot-reloads its configuration from the Corvid store every 30 seconds. If a bad config wedges the reload loop, normal rollback tooling won't respond, and you must use break-glass access to push a known-good snapshot directly. Break-glass requires two approvals plus the standing recovery passphrase, which is recorded below for on-call reference.

vault phrase of bagaf-kajeg = jorath-feniel-briir-siliel-ralix

Changed defaults in Splitfork, our assignment service. Bucketing now uses sticky hashing per account instead of per session, and the holdout slice grew from 2% to 5%. Callers relying on session-level reassignment must opt in explicitly. Review the diff against the new baseline; the updated default configuration is listed below.

config for tagep-kajof:
[casir]
port = 6379
region = south-1
host = casir.paliqdyn.example
team = tamax
timeout_ms = 250
retries = 2

**Onboarding: Terravane Offline Mode**

Maintainers should know that the Terravane field-survey app queues submissions locally when connectivity drops and syncs on reconnect. Never purge the local store manually — conflict resolution depends on its sequence markers. If a device's encrypted offline cache must be unlocked for debugging, use the recovery passphrase listed below.

recovery phrase for bawep-kawef: oliath-casdor

# Break-Glass: Fieldmark Offline Mode

For weekly eng sync. If Fieldmark's survey app loses sync auth in the field, break-glass unlocks the local cache for 24h. Use only when the relay at Dunmore is unreachable. Log every use in the access channel. Enter the recovery passphrase below at the offline unlock prompt.

vault phrase of taweg-kafof = oliax-zorael